John Baldwin wrote: >> Completely unrelated, but may save you a search later on. Your VIA C7's >> CPU ID is identical to mine (0x6d0), which the 6 and 7-series kernels >> don't detect as such (evident by the "VIA/IDT Unknown" CPU in your >> dmesg). If you want to use the padlock crypto features of the CPU you >> will need to patch the initcpu.c and identcpu.c files in /sys/i386/i386 >> and build a new kernel. The patch below works under 6.3-RELEASE > > Committed a variation (called it C7 Eden) to HEAD and will MFC in a few days. > Thank you!!
